In one universe, six extraordinary people join forces to save the world. Battles are won, lives are saved, yet, in the end, the team falls apart and half the universe's population is wiped out of existence as a consequence. 

In another universe, seven extraordinary people join forces to save the world... and end up saving the entire universe instead.

Alanna Becker is the catalyst in a war between good and evil - a war she doesn't realize she's fighting until she gets a call in the middle of the night that her uncle is missing... and so is the Tesseract. To get him back, she has to rejoin Shield and the Avengers - and face a past she thought she put behind her.
